Product Introduction

Overview

The ADuM1400WSRWZ is a quad-channel digital isolator produced by Analog Devices Inc., utilizing the company's proprietary iCoupler® technology. This component combines high-speed CMOS and monolithic air core transformer technology to provide superior performance characteristics compared to traditional optocoupler devices. The ADuM1400WSRWZ eliminates the need for external drivers and discrete components, reducing design complexity and power consumption. It operates with supply voltages ranging from 2.7 V to 5.5 V on both sides, enabling compatibility with lower voltage systems and voltage translation across the isolation barrier.

Key Features

  • High-Speed CMOS and Monolithic Air Core Transformer Technology: Provides superior performance compared to optocoupler devices.
  • Low Power Consumption: Consumes one-tenth to one-sixth of the power of optocouplers at comparable signal data rates.
  • Voltage Translation: Operates with supply voltages ranging from 2.7 V to 5.5 V on both sides, enabling compatibility with lower voltage systems.
  • Low Pulse Width Distortion and Tight Channel-to-Channel Matching: Ensures reliable and precise signal transmission.
  • Patented Refresh Feature: Ensures dc correctness in the absence of input logic transitions and when power is not applied to one of the supplies.
